Išleido naują „NetworkManager 1.20.0“ versiją ir tai yra jos pakeitimai

„NetworkManager“

Įtraukta Pastaruoju metu buvo paskelbtas naujos stabilios sąsajos versijos leidimas, siekiant supaprastinti tinklo konfigūraciją „NetworkManager 1.20“, versija, kurioje pridėta keletas naujovių, tačiau svarbiausia - klaidų taisymai ir didesnis palaikymas.

„NetworkManager“ yra įrankis, pasirinkdamas oportunistinį požiūrį, bandant naudoti geriausią prieinamą ryšį, kai įvyksta nutrūkimų arba kai vartotojas juda tarp belaidžių tinklų. Jums labiau patinka „Ethernet“ ryšys, o ne „žinomas“ belaidis tinklas. Vartotojui, jei reikia, siūloma įvesti WEP arba WPA raktus.

„NetworkManager“ turi du komponentus:

  1. paslauga, kuri valdo ryšius ir praneša apie tinklo pokyčius.
  2. grafinė darbalaukio programa, leidžianti vartotojui manipuliuoti tinklo jungtimis. „Nmcli“ programėlė suteikia panašią funkciją komandinėje eilutėje.

Iš kitos pusės VPN, „OpenConnect“, PPTP, „OpenVPN“ ir „OpenSWAN“ palaikantys papildiniai yra kuriami kaip jų pačių kūrimo ciklų dalis.

Įskiepiai, palaikantys VPN, „OpenConnect“, PPTP, „OpenVPN“ ir „OpenSWAN“, yra kuriami kaip jų pačių kūrimo ciklų dalis.

Pagrindinės naujos „NetworkManager 1.20“ funkcijos

Šioje naujoje versijoje pakeistas konfigūracijos valdymo papildinio diegimas ir profilių saugojimo diske būdas. Pridėta ryšio profilių perkėlimo tarp papildinių palaikymas.

Saugomi profiliai atminimui dabar juos apdoroja tik rakto failo papildinys ir išsaugo / run kataloge, kuris neleidžia prarasti profilių iš naujo paleidus „NetworkManager“, ir leidžia naudoti FS pagrįstą API, kad būtų galima sukurti profilius atmintyje.

Be to, jis taip pat pabrėžia išvalytus pasenusius komponentus naudingojoje programoje. Visų pirma, buvo pašalinta „libnm-glib“ biblioteka, kurią „NetworkManager 1.0“ pakeitė „libnm“ biblioteka, pašalintas „ibft“ papildinys (tinklo konfigūracijos duomenims perduoti iš programinės aparatinės įrangos turėtų būti naudojamas „initrd“ nm-initrd-generatorius) ir palaikymas „. main.monitor- connection files "tinkle„ NetworkManager.conf “(turite aiškiai vadinti„ nmcli connection load “arba„ nmcli connection reload “).

Pagal numatytuosius nustatymus įtaisytasis DHCP klientas yra įjungtas („vidinis“ režimas) vietoj anksčiau naudotos „dhclient“ programos. Numatytąjį galite pakeisti naudodami surinkimo parinktį „–with-config-dhcp-default“ arba konfigūracijos faile nustatydami main.dhcp.

Kita vertus, yra naujas „D-Bus AddConnection2“ () metodas, leidžiantis blokuoti automatinį profilio sujungimą jo sukūrimo metu.

Prie „Update2 ()“ metodo buvo pridėta vėliava „Netaikyti iš naujo“, pagal kurią pakeitus ryšio profilio turinį, faktiniai įrenginio parametrai automatiškai nepakeičiami tol, kol profilis vėl neaktyvinamas.

O skirtingiems paskirstymams suteikiama galimybė patalpinti siuntimo scenarijus kataloge / usr / lib / NetworkManager, kuris gali būti naudojamas sistemos vaizduose, kurie yra prieinami tik skaitymo režimu ir išvalomi / ir kt.

Iš kitų šioje naujoje versijoje išsiskiriančių pakeitimų galime rasti:

  • Pridėtas parametras „ipv6.method = disabled“, leidžiantis išjungti įrenginio IPv6.
  • Pridėta belaidžių tinklų, kurių kiekvienas mazgas yra sujungtas per kaimyninius mazgus, palaikymas
  • Papildoma galimybė sukonfigūruoti „fq_codel“ („Fair Queue Controlled Delay“) paketų eilių sudarymo drausmę ir veidrodinius veiksmus, kad atspindėtų srautą
  • „Libnm“ modifikuotas konfigūracijos JSON formatu kodas ir numatytas griežtesnis parametrų tikrinimas.
  • Maršrutavimo taisyklėse prie šaltinio adreso pridedamas atributo „suppress_prefixlength“ palaikymas (strategijos nukreipimas).
  • „WireGuard“ VPN palaiko scenarijus, kad automatiškai priskirtų numatytąjį maršrutą „wireguard.ip4-auto-default-route“ ir „wireguard.ip6-auto-default-route“.

Kaip gauti „NetworkManager 1.20.0“?

Tiems, kurie nori įsigyti šią naują „NetworkManager 1.20.0“ versiją, turėtumėte žinoti, kad šiuo metu nėra jokių paketų, skirtų „Ubuntu“, ar išvestinių priemonių. Taigi, jei norite gauti šią versiją jie turi sukurti „NetworkManager 1.20.0“ iš šaltinio kodo.

Nuoroda yra tokia.


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Atsakingas už duomenis: Miguel Ángel Gatón
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.